Criteria for Ranking

When ranking mutual funds, several factors are taken into consideration, including historical performance, expense ratios, management team, and investment strategy. These factors help investors determine which mutual funds are likely to provide the best returns over time.

Top Performing Mutual Funds

Vanguard Total Stock Market Index Fund (VTSAX)

VTSAX is a popular mutual fund that tracks the performance of the entire U.S. stock market. With a low expense ratio and consistent returns, this fund is a favorite among long-term investors looking for diversified exposure to the stock market.

Fidelity Contrafund (FCNTX)

FCNTX is a large-cap growth mutual fund that has consistently outperformed its benchmark over the years. Managed by a team of experienced professionals, this fund is known for its ability to pick winning stocks and generate strong returns for investors.

T. Rowe Price Blue Chip Growth Fund (TRBCX)

TRBCX is a growth-oriented mutual fund that focuses on investing in large-cap companies with strong growth potential. With a solid track record of performance and a seasoned management team, this fund is a top choice for investors seeking exposure to high-growth stocks.
